TypeScript 配列の要素をシャッフルするサンプル

環境
Windows 11 Pro 64bit
TypeScript 4.4.4

構文
配列名.sort((引数1, 引数2) => 0.5 – Math.random())
配列からsort()を呼び出します。
sort()の引数に、2つの引数を持つラムダ式を指定します。

使用例

const res: number[] = [11, 32, 43, 54, 65]

res.sort((a, b) => 0.5 - Math.random())

console.log(res)

実行結果
[LOG]: [11, 32, 54, 65, 43]

TypeScript

Posted by arkgame